WebApr 12, 2024 · Headquartered in Alexandria, Va., the company has over 2,000 agents and more than 60 offices, providing complete real estate services nationwide and helping … WebApr 4, 2024 · Each branch of the military has age limits to enlist in active duty: Air Force: 17 - 39. Army: 17 - 35. Coast Guard: 17 - 31. Marine Corps: 17 - 28. Navy: 17 - 39. Space Force: 17 - 39. The age limits are different if you join as …

WebApr 17, 2024 · The meaning of “branches of government” refers to the legislative, executive, and judicial branches of the U.S. government. Each of the branches has its own powers. For example, branches of government have the power to make laws (legislative branch), enforce laws (executive branch), and apply those laws to applicable situations …
